Output 95e70c29beab68ec87206ed45d49c01093c04902734b657bedf2b8aaa0e27ee5:25

value
46940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eef3ae81b8db4ee9d5e17116d0f11f47a5fcba5f OP_EQUAL
address
3PUUfVrzSA4jS1cVYzDQQth3pKzGZdXyGa
transaction
95e70c29beab68ec87206ed45d49c01093c04902734b657bedf2b8aaa0e27ee5
spent
true